Transaction 20f81057fa3c26fe11f0c321d4f949dd9f665448baf0787e44bce29a2b5ca161

25 Input
2 Outputs
  • 20f81057fa3c26fe11f0c321d4f949dd9f665448baf0787e44bce29a2b5ca161:0
  • value  26946590
    address  17Y4f1H3fxTkR9vGGqJ6aQv6hWNfuY31ag
  • 20f81057fa3c26fe11f0c321d4f949dd9f665448baf0787e44bce29a2b5ca161:1
  • value  1000598
    address  35bojExyCJkXsK3sCHbSDB8TVzjmDsNHF6